Number Five
Solomons Tale is a book that I adored, its about a cat who is sent to look after a family in need and its a very sweet heart warming story.A story of love, courage and strength. You’ll laugh, cry and never look at cat in the same way again. Its like cats and Christmas rolled into one…This book was published on the 21st of November by Avon books, written by Sheila Jeffries.

Number Two
I read A Passionate Love Affair With a Total Stranger at the very start of 2013 and it has stuck with me ever since, its not your average soppy predictable love story; It brings a whole new meaning to love stories and it’s exciting, it’s not just about passion and romance it’s filled with mystery and abundant with hilarity.
This book was published on the 31st of January by Penguin, written by Lucy Robinson.
Number One
Billy and Me had me with the cover alone and was my most memorable read of 2013. This is a debut novel that anyone would be proud of and perfect for its genre. Warm, funny, and absolutely addictive!
Not many books have had my crying one moment and laughing the next (Especially not in public, on the train!) I cannot wait to read more from this author in the new year.
This book was published on the 23rd of May by Penguin Michael Joseph, written by Giovanna Fletcher.
